Claims
- 1. An apparatus adapted for entrapment of medical sharps comprising:
a shell having an upper portion and a lower portion; an expandable hinge connecting the upper portion to the lower portion; and a first pad affixed to an inside surface of the lower portion, the first pad comprising:
a first adhesive layer; and a first gap-filling deformable layer disposed between the first adhesive layer and the inside surface of the lower portion; wherein a medical sharp set on the first adhesive layer is trapped between the upper portion and the lower portion when the shell is closed.

- 18. A method of disposal for a used medical sharp, the method comprising:
providing an open disposable sharps containment device at a point-of-use of a medical sharp; placing the medical sharp onto the open disposable sharps containment device at the point-of-use, wherein the medical sharp comprises a sharp portion and a blunt portion; closing the open disposable sharps containment device at the point-of-use, wherein the sharp portion of the medical sharp is embedded within the closed disposable containment device, and the blunt portion of the medical sharp protrudes from the closed disposable sharps containment device; and transporting the closed disposable sharps containment device including the embedded medical sharp to a medical waste disposal container remotely located from the point-of-use of the medical sharp.

- 25. A pad for entrapment of a medical sharp comprising:
an adhesive layer; and a gap-filling deformable layer disposed below the adhesive layer, wherein the gap-filling deformable layer substantially deforms to a contour of a medical sharp to fill substantially all gaps around the contour of the medical sharp when the medical sharp is pressed into the adhesive layer.
